1 MANAGEMENT OF NEONATAL HYPOTENSION CLINICAL GUIDELINE 1. Aim/Purpose of this Guideline 1.1. To provide guidance on the assessment and management of infants with hypotension. All involved will benefit from the improvement in service and timing 2. The Guidance 2.1. Background. Very low birth weight (VLBW, wt <1500 gm) preterm babies are at higher risk of hypotension, especially in first 24 hrs. Hypotension in such babies is associated with a higher incidence of intraventricular haemorrhage and poor neuro-developmental outcome. Term infants with hypoic ischemic encephalopathy or sepsis are also at risk of hypotension When to treat? Monitoring of intra-arterial blood pressure through an umbilical or peripheral arterial catheter is widely accepted as the optimum method, oscillometric measurement at the lower levels in particular overestimates the blood pressure. Blood pressure is widely used as a surrogate marker of tissue perfusion. A mean arterial pressure (MAP) equivalent to the gestational age in weeks corresponds to 10 th centile of MAP for that particular gestation, and has generally been the threshold to consider starting treatment. There is growing evidence that blood pressure may not always be a true reflection of systemic tissue perfusion. Hence MAP as a guide to start treatment should be used in contet of other markers of tissue perfusion like metabolic acidosis, lactate, capillary refill time, urinary output, and peripheral temperature. If available, information from an echocardiogram may be a useful adjunct (for eample superior vena cava blood flow or right ventricular output) Underlying Causes. If a baby is hypotensive look for underlying causes appropriately. Common causes include: Acute blood loss Pneumothora Heart failure. Drugs including opiates Adrenocortical insufficiency Sepsis High positive intrathoracic pressure in ventilated babies Page 1 of 7

2 Patent Arterial Duct Hypocalcaemia / hypomagnesaemia 2.4 Adopt step wise approach Step 1: Consider Hypovolaemia Hypovolaemia is an uncommon cause of hypotension in sick preterm newborn but moderate volume epansion has been a common first step before the institution of ionotropes. Saline has been shown to be equally effective as human albumin solution. Use of 4.5% Human Albumen Solution should be reserved for infants with protein losing condition for eample post gastrointestinal surgery. Hypovolaemia is difficult to diagnose and inotropes are less effective in a hypovolaemic infant. Volume Epansion Normal (0.9%) Saline: 10 ml/kg infused over 30 minutes, can be repeated once. If there is evidence of blood loss a blood transfusion should be given. Step 2: Inotropes There is limited evidence for selection of inotropes in hypotensive newborns. Dobutamine is suggested as preferred choice. Second and third line drugs are added as below: In VLBW Preterm babies <24 hrs of age (normal to low Mean Arterial Pressure with high vascular resistance) 1 st : Dobutamine 5-20micrograms/kg/min 2 nd : Dopamine 5-20 micrograms/kg/min 3 rd : Adrenaline (or Noradrenaline) 0.1 to 0.5micrograms/kg/min* (100 to 500 nanograms/kg/min) In Preterm babies >24 hrs and term babies (low Mean Arterial Pressure with vasodilatation) 1 st : Dopamine 5-20 micrograms/kg/min 2 nd : Dobutamine 5-20 micrograms/kg/min 3 rd : Adrenaline(or Noradrenaline) 0.1 to 1.0 microgram/kg/min* (100 nanograms/kg/min to 1 microgram/kg/min) *When using Adrenaline / Noradrenaline consider stopping dopamine Step 3: Steroids Antenatal steroids have been shown to have an independent effect on reducing the incidence of hypotension in preterm infants. The hypothesis is that infants with refractory hypotension may have relative adrenal insufficiency and cause them to be incapable of responding to sympathomimetic drugs. A suggested regime for Hydrocortisone: 2.5 mg/kg IV every 6 hours for 2 days 1.25 mg/kg IV every 6 hours for 2 days 0.625mg/kg IV every 6 hours for 2 days 2.5. Prescribing Information Dopamine (5ml vial containing 40mg/ml) 37.5 mg/kg in 25 ml of 5% detrose; run at 0.2 to 0.8 ml/hr (5-20 mcg/kg/min) Page 2 of 7

3 Dobutamine (20ml vial containing 12.5mg/ml) 37.5 mg/kg in 25 ml of 5% detrose; run at 0.2 to 0.8 ml/hr (5-20 mcg/kg/min) Adrenaline (1ml ampule of 1 in 1000 containing 1mg/ml.) or Noradrenaline (4ml ampule of 1 in 1000 containing 1mg/ml) 150 mcg/kg in 25 ml normal saline run at 0.1ml/hr for a dose of 0.01 mcg/kg/min 3.
